Why Fabric Choice Matters in Exporting Cushions
Selecting the correct fabric for cushions destined for international markets requires balancing comfort, durability, and compliance with global safety standards. Exporters must understand the critical differences between 100% cotton and polyester-cotton blends (commonly 65% polyester / 35% cotton) to provide products that satisfy both consumer expectations and regulatory demands.
Cotton Vs. Polyester-Cotton Blend: Performance Metrics
| Fabric Feature |
100% Cotton |
Polyester-Cotton Blend |
| Comfort & Breathability |
Excellent air permeability; soft hand feel; excellent skin friendliness |
Moderate breathability; slightly less soft but more wrinkle-resistant |
| Durability & Wrinkle Resistance |
Less durable; prone to creasing and abrasion over prolonged use |
Higher durability; resists wear and wrinkles well, ideal for frequent use |
| Maintenance |
Requires gentle washing; prone to shrinkage |
Easy to clean; retains shape and color after repeated washes |
| Cost & Market Preference |
Higher cost; preferred in premium segments focusing on natural fibers |
More cost-effective; widely accepted in mass-market exports |
The Role of PP Cotton Filling in Cushion Quality
Beyond surface fabric, the choice of PP cotton filling (polypropylene cotton) significantly influences cushion performance. High-resilience PP cotton offers excellent loftiness and superior rebound effect, maintaining cushion shape and comfort even after thousands of compressions. Its hydrophobic nature also resists moisture accumulation, enhancing hygiene and lifespan — critical factors for fulfilling ISO9001 quality management and GB 18401-2010 A-level safety standards required for export certification.
International Safety and Quality Certifications for Export Cushions
To ensure compliance with global market requirements, cushion fabrics and fillings must meet rigorous standards:
- GB 18401-2010 A-level: China's national safety standard for textile products emphasizing low formaldehyde content, acceptable pH levels, and absence of harmful substances.
- ISO9001: Quality management system ensuring consistent manufacturing processes and product quality.
- Third-Party Testing: Reports from SGS, Intertek, or TÜV validate safety and durability claims, reassuring international buyers.
A product passing these certifications guarantees reliability and enhances brand credibility in competitive export markets.
Target Audiences and Use Cases: Matching Fabric to Market Expectations
When approaching different international customer segments, fabric selection must align with buyer priorities:
- Premium Home Decor Retailers: Favor 100% cotton cushions for superior comfort and eco-friendly appeal.
- Hospitality Sector: Prefer polyester-cotton blends for durability and ease of maintenance.
- Mass-Market Exporters: Opt for polyester-cotton mix balances cost and acceptable comfort.
- Health-Conscious Buyers: Require fully certified fabrics with hypoallergenic PP cotton filling.
